Output 77f5feaf07e79c5af5d9f383375f866856a20bf0447960ff54764f656bdcf4f5:0

value
622602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20346bff99bf78ddb7047c820f8fbf6eb1701d49 OP_EQUAL
address
34dJM1ya7C6bQyzpLhqxntHHathegZLYTJ
transaction
77f5feaf07e79c5af5d9f383375f866856a20bf0447960ff54764f656bdcf4f5